When is the best time to stay at a B&B in Waimauku?
When you’re planning your trip to Waimauku, year-round temperatures and rainfall may be important factors to consider. The hottest months are usually February and January with an average temp of 66°F, while the coldest months are July and August with an average of 55°F. Average annual precipitation for Waimauku is 50 inches.

How can I get to and around Waimauku?
You can map out your trip in and around Waimauku ahead of time with these transportation options. Fly into Auckland Intl. Airport (AKL), which is located 22.9 mi (36.9 km) from the heart of the city. If you’d like to explore around the area, consider renting a car to take in more sights.
